One of Cornwall's most popular tourist attractions, the Eden Project boasts the largest greenhouse in the world. Situated about 3 miles north of St Austell, the Eden Project is built in an unused china clay pit and comprises a number of huge plastic domes, housing plant species from all around the world.

The project , which took over 2 years to complete, opened in 2001, it was designed by architect Nicholas Grimshaw and was the brainchild of Tim Smit.
